Component: PA-OS
Component Name: Organizational Structure
Description: An object that is located at the highest level in a hierarchical structure, for example the organizational structure.
Key Concepts: Root object is a term used in the SAP PA-OS Organizational Structure component. It is the highest level of an organizational structure, and all other objects are subordinate to it. The root object is the starting point for all other objects in the organizational structure. How to use it: The root object is used to define the overall structure of an organization. It can be used to define the hierarchy of an organization, such as departments, divisions, and teams. It can also be used to define relationships between different objects in the organizational structure. Tips & Tricks: When creating a root object, it is important to consider how it will be used in the future. For example, if you plan to add additional objects to the organizational structure in the future, you should create a root object that can accommodate them.
